I have a power filter for filtration. A Whisper 30-60 for my 29 gallon tank. Do any of you's recommend to mix a underground filtration with a power filter? I'm just kickin the idea around of having an underground filter along with my power filter. Anyone think this is a good idea? Or should I not mix those 2 together?? Tho some people still favour the UGF, they are quickly falling out of favour for the power and cannister filters.

I find power filters to be quite good (if you want to save a few $$ on media for that filter, go to petsmart and get a topfin cartridge, it is bi fold (to halves come together) allowing you to put regular floss in the cartridge (cost about 1$/Sq. yd. instead of 10$ for a box of 8 filters. Also works if you want to use carbon or any other media.. (just tossing this in as a bit of helpful info)
